Speech boundary detection contributes to performance of speech based applications such as speech recognition and speaker recognition. Speech boundary detector implemented in this study works on broadcast audio as a pre-processor module of a keyword spotter. Speech boundary detection is handled in 3 steps. At first step, audio data is segmented into homogeneous regions in an unsupervised manner. The use of speech recognition on mobile devices has been possible with the development of cloud systems and has been used for about 10 years. However, in noisy environments, the problem of speech recognition with low error rate still persists. In this study, different speech samples have been recorded using a compact microphone array in noisy environments and a data set has been created by processing them with a real-time noise cancellation algorithm.
